Logistics Administration Specialist
We are currently seeking a dynamic and driven Logistics Administration Specialist to join our team. The Logistics Administration Specialist is responsible for handling indirect material. Performs cycle counts of raw, semi-finished and finished goods in the Business Units. Also, performs a variety of administrative tasks in support of the logistics department.
Job Type: Full-time, 1st Shift - 8:00 am to 4:30 pm
Work Location: In person (Gainesville, GA)
Responsibilities:
- Ordering, receiving, booking, and distributing indirect materials
- Invoice verification process for indirect and direct material as well as freight invoices
- Cycle counts of material to support Material planner
- Communicating variances to Material Planner
- Creating shipping paperwork to support Production Planner
- Process customs formalities
- Scheduling customer material pick-ups in cooperation with production planner
- Archiving of documents i.e. production orders, BOL, and delivery notes
- Following International Automotive Task Force quality standards – IATF 16949
- Teamwork – train employees and assisting others with more difficult tasks
- Escalation of issues to supervisor
- Following Internal Quality Issues procedure – IQI
- Ensuring First in – First out
- Ensuring safety rules and policies are followed
- Housekeeping – 6IMS-Standard
- Other duties as assigned

**Job Summary and Qualifications**
The Supply Chain Technician is responsible for receiving, keying, and promptly distributing all supplies within the facility, as well as reviewing and maintaining all Min/Max levels for storeroom safety stock as well as all other stocking locations. The Supply Chain Technician is also responsible for conducting physical inventories of all POU areas according to the defined schedule.
What you will do in this role:
+ Deliver supplies in an accurate and timely manner
+ Is authorized to transport and deliver legend drugs, non-prescription drugs, contrast media and drug-containing devices relative to core competencies of the position
+ Place safety stock in proper location
+ Receive expedited deliveries, accurately key receiving into the SMART system, and deliver to appropriate department(s)
+ Receive all cross-docked items into the SMART system as appropriate
+ Review Min/Max for storeroom safety stock daily and place orders appropriately
+ Count par level areas (POU areas) weekly according to schedule
+ Ensure POU items have the appropriate barcodes
+ Perform QA random checks on totes per approved policy
+ Rotate stock in POU areas and backup storeroom areas to ensure no items are out of date
+ Check after-hour logs for charges and determine how to avoid reoccurrence
+ React appropriately to POU "critical point" messages and stock outs
+ Process all "returns to vendor" or "returns to backup stock" appropriately
+ Provide assistance to the POU Station personnel as well as provide assistance with problems, questions and concerns at the nurse's stations
